'Smart' Mailboxes Could Message Consumers

"Smart" mailboxes equipped with sensors could automatically scan a parcel's barcode and generate an electronic delivery confirmation, reducing costs and improving customer service. Sensors attached to U.S. Postal Service vehicles could significantly cut fuel, maintenance and transportation costs. And a network of sensors in facilities could monitor environmental systems in an effort to reduce energy and maintenance costs or improve security and safety.
